re PR tree-optimization/31081 (Inliner messes up SSA for abnormals)
PR tree-optimization/31081 * tree-inline.c (remap_ssa_name): Initialize uninitialized SSA vars to 0 when inlining and not inlining to first basic block. (remap_decl): When var is initialized to 0, don't set default_def. (expand_call_inline): Set entry_bb. * tree-inline.h (copy_body_data): Add entry_bb. From-SVN: r131306

/* By inlining function having uninitialized variable, we might
|
||||
extend the lifetime (variable might get reused). This cause
|
||||
ICE in the case we end up extending lifetime of SSA name across
|
||||
abnormal edge, but also increase register presure.
|
||||
|
||||
We simply initialize all uninitialized vars by 0 except for case
|
||||
we are inlining to very first BB. We can avoid this for all
|
||||
BBs that are not withing strongly connected regions of the CFG,
|
||||
but this is bit expensive to test.
|
||||
*/
